Femtosecond Studies of Orientationai Anisotropy Decay of Benzopyranthione in the Excited 52 State in Hydrocarbons

Reorientational dynamics of 4H-l-benzopyrane-4-thione (BPT) in the S2 state, in hydrocarbon solution, is studied from the anisotropy decay of fluorescence upconversion and pump-probe absorption transients with femtosecond time resolution. The anisotropy decay is found to be monoexponential in n-hexane, «-heptane, «-octane, «-decane, «-dodecane and cyclohexane. The dependence of the rotational time constant, r„,-, on the solvent viscosity is approximated by a linear function with a slope of 2.6 ± 1 ps/cP indicating slip conditions.
